1 - Install Naturalistic ENB following carefully the instructions on the page;
2 - Install ENBBoost (CTD and Mmory patch) http://www.nexusmods.com/skyrim/mods/38649/? to stabilize your game, also following the Instructions and How to Configure carefully - don't worry, it is simple, you just have to know your computer RAM and Video Memory;
3 - download and Run SMCO http://www.nexusmods.com/skyrim/mods/13529/ - this small program process all your mod .dds textures files (and textures inside BSA files) optimizing them, meaning that they will occupy less space on disk, less memory in-game (leading to less CTD) and faster load times in-game.
My computer is medium-low and it runs at 60 FPS without a problem with tons of texture mods for everything.

This ENB don't use MCM menu, it is tweaked via ENB menu (not MCM).
Only Dynavision uses MCM menu to tweak the Depth of Field in combat, running, interiors...
